Church
St Leonard's Church in , Wiltshire, England, was built in the 12th century. It is recorded in the National Heritage List for England as a designated Grade II* listed building, and is now a redundant church in the care of the Churches Conservation Trust. is situated 3,400 feet northwest of Fonthill Arch.
